How have you gone about painting these,I tried painting an army of scythes a long time ago by undercoating/painting everything seperately before building them white undercoat for the yellow areas ,black for the black obviously the whole thing took absolutely ages so I shelved them,any advice might see them re-surface.

harrybuttwhisker
06-20-2010, 09:33 AM
spray whole model black

basecoat - iyanden darksun
first shade - graveyard earth
second shade - scorched brown
first highlight - 50:50 iyanden:vallejo game colour golden yellow
second highlight - vgc golden yellow
third highlight - 60:40 vallejo model colour ivory:vgc golden yellow
glaze - 50:50 red:yellow ink

then hit with dullcoat

shading is done with thin washes working back into the recesses treating the basecoat as a midtone. You can replace the vallejo colours with golden yellow and bleached bone i just prefer the slightly different tones the vallejo colours have. Inks are old school GW inks. Graveyard can be swapped for khemri brown as well as they are mostly interchangeable.

...Need to the blend the transfers into the paint more too, really obvious in the photos...

It's a bit of a pain, but I got rid of decal marks with this process: (paint), apply gloss varnish, then decal, then decal solvent, then gloss varnish (at this point I do the whole thing for weathering stage one), (more painting, weathering, varnish etc), matt or semigloss enamel varnish. Between the decal solvent and the last coat of enamel it seems to melt the clear into the gloss varnish.

@shadow queen i've been asked about the combi-weapon on other forums so when I do my next one i'll be taking and posting photos but it's real simple.

@gwensdad dont be ashamed of hating ultramarines, be ashamed of supporting the colts lol

harrybuttwhisker
08-21-2010, 10:55 AM
Ok here goes, first of all you will need tools

1)Clippers
2)Knife
3)Superglue
4)Pinvice
5)1mm drill bits

The bits you will need are

1)space marine commander plastic boltgun-melta combi weapon
2)blood angel death company handflamer

http://i145.photobucket.com/albums/r228/noneedforaname_album/DSCF0510.jpg

Step 1 - chopping mercilessly

At this stage you can use clippers to roughly remove areas we dont need such as the melta gun barrel and the main body of the handflamer til you have something looking roughly like this.

http://i145.photobucket.com/albums/r228/noneedforaname_album/DSCF0512.jpg

this is the ideal time to drill out the bareels using a pinvice as if you do it later in there new positions they will probably snap off.

Step 2 - SHAVE IT!

being very careful, knives can be sharp, we gently slice the boltgun barrel away trying not to distort it shape before cleaning up the front of the bolter body so it is nice and smooth mmmm. Then we also carefully pare away the boby of the handflamer leaving only the barrel and hose assembly so we end up with something like this.

http://i145.photobucket.com/albums/r228/noneedforaname_album/DSCF0513.jpg

Stage 3 - Getting Sticky

simply stick the barrels in the new positions so it looks a bit like this and hey presto we are done.

http://i145.photobucket.com/albums/r228/noneedforaname_album/DSCF0514.jpg

I am having trouble seeing how you attached the model to the base. Right now it looks like a very fragile attachment. Is there some sort of reinforcement?

RedWidow
11-26-2010, 10:51 PM
This is a very exciting thread. The models are really attractive, and your progress seems steady. Your yellow looks exceptional. Would love to see an army pic...with all of the models you have finished so far. :D

harrybuttwhisker
11-27-2010, 05:05 AM
@tynskel it's arttached at two pints via the landing skid thing, its been internally reinforced with steel rod through it all up into the body so the metal carries the weight rather than the plastic. It also comes apart for transport so means it doesn't have to be uber reinforced. the base is also full of steel shot so no chance of it overbalancing.

awesome. If you have pictures, it'd be cool if you posted how you made the reenforcement of the land speeder with the Rods. How to shots can be just as cool as the finished product!

harrybuttwhisker
12-02-2010, 04:29 PM
Unfortunately I didn't take any photos but essential it involves cutting away the corners on the runner thing and drilling a hole through the entire length of each straight bit, threading steel wire through it then building the corners back up with modelling putty.

Tedious but worth it.
